DESCRIPTION: | No. 59614 |
Mineral: | Schorl Tourmaline on Albite with Muscovite |
Locality: | Mursinka, Sverdlovskaya Oblast', Middle Urals, Russia |
Description: | Elongated lustrous black schorl tourmaline crystals to 32 mm on white albite with translucent olive-yellow-green muscovite crystals to 0.2 mm. The schorl tourmalines are segments that were enclosed by the white albite after they fractured. Ex. Fersman Mineralogical Museum (Moscow) |
Overall Size: | 14x7x5 cm |
Crystals: | 0.2-32.0 mm |
